Vance Leads US Delegation to Iran Amid Threats
VP JD Vance leads the US delegation to Iran despite serious security concerns, showing Trump's resolve to confront the regime head-on. Negotiators head to Islamabad for talks, but Iranians may skip, while Trump floats visiting Pakistan himself for the second round.
